Gas fireplace rep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ues that affect the operation and safety of gas-powered fireplaces. Technicians inspect components such as gas lines, ignition systems, burners, and thermostats to identify problems like faulty igniters, gas leaks, or damaged valves. Repairs may include replacing worn-out parts, cleaning burners, or adjusting settings to ensure proper functioning. These services help restore the fireplace’s performance, improve efficiency, and prevent potential safety hazards associated with malfunctioning units.

Common problems addressed through gas fireplace repair include inconsistent flames, trouble igniting, or the fireplace not turning on at all. Over time, deposits can build up within the system, or parts may wear out, leading to inefficient operation or safety concerns. Repair services also resolve issues like strange noises, gas odors, or pilot light problems. Addressing these issues promptly helps maintain a safe environment and ensures the fireplace operates smoothly during colder months or for ambiance purposes.

The overview below groups typical Gas Fireplace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Maywood,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- Typical expenses for gas fireplace repairs range from $150 to $500, depending on the issue. For example, fixing a faulty ignition might cost around $200, while replacing a broken burner could be closer to $450.

Replacement Parts - The cost of replacement parts varies widely, from $50 for basic components to over $300 for major parts like control valves. Prices depend on the specific part needed and the fireplace model.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for gas fireplace repairs usually fall between $75 and $150 per hour. Total costs depend on the complexity and duration of the repair, often taking a few hours to complete.

Service Estimates - Many local service providers offer estimates ranging from $100 to $400 for repair assessments. These quotes help determine the scope of work and associated costs before proceeding with rep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
